Transaction 73d3addc20b3c5e1b677c24a3c2e578265ed7dab42fb62af51178e0b6d65bc63
1 Input
1 Output
-
73d3addc20b3c5e1b677c24a3c2e578265ed7dab42fb62af51178e0b6d65bc63:0
- value
- 3578926
- script pubkey
- OP_0 OP_PUSHBYTES_20 0dbdfabd47a9115ec0fc7417bdc0e0d096570042
- address
- bc1qpk7l40284yg4as8uwstmms8q6zt9wqzzglq2hz